4453  Economy / Gambling discussion / Re: Play poker to train trading on: July 19, 2019, 11:43:58 PM
<snip...>


While I do respect your opinion, I still view poker as something that is more randomized compared to trading due to a number of reasons.

First, poker is a game wherein cards are randomized by a deck of cards with someone dealing the cards. Depending on the cards shown on the table, you make your bet pairing your hand. If you think that the pool is weak, you can discard your hand and wait for the next deal. On the other hand, you may also play the bluffing game by letting the opponents think that you have the strongest set of combinations of cards paired with the existing pool.

But what separates poker from trading is the manner of risking such. Although both have risks that are difficult to manage, in trading you rely on historical data, market situation, external and internal news in the country, etc. as it is multifactorial. Someone who is not knowledgeable in gambling can win loads of cash purely by luck. In trading, I doubt that happens since even experienced traders get bankrupted at the end of the cycle.

4460  Economy / Gambling discussion / Re: What causes a person to become intensely addicted to gambling? on: July 13, 2019, 02:39:03 AM
actually simple, when you win a gamble, someone wants to come back again for a victory that is bigger than yesterday. if you lose, someone will come back again to take revenge for yesterday's defeat. both sides make people always think of going back to the gambling table, because of their own desires.
In short. Revenge gambling + Greediness.

If you win this day, you feel that you are lucky and then you will come back to the casino to gamble (greed). Now if the table turns down to you and you lose today, you will feel that you need to get your money back and will gamble again until you lose your money again (revenge). This is the reason why gamblers are getting addicted into gambling.

Gambling creates this endless cycle wherein an individual gets stuck on a continuous loop of winning and losing, getting lost in the illusion that he/she can overcome his/her losses by betting again. Due to this conflict, one may think that he is actually earning cash but in reality, his losses are overwhelmingly more than his winnings. In order to overcome this adversity, it is highly advisable that you set-up a limit in terms of your betting to avoid betting more than you planned for.
